Output ed3c941cb20ab4035624cda133d1e51a9c0aebdc8353f5905d01902c05cdc756:0

value
21542604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d68daf095a5a4d89233b9b82edcc93996ba3447 OP_EQUAL
address
3Eaip4W6qhM5955mpgUpbLwDpjJ29EnAdp
transaction
ed3c941cb20ab4035624cda133d1e51a9c0aebdc8353f5905d01902c05cdc756
spent
true